Summary:Title inscribed in pencil l.l.. Inscribed in pencil l.c.: "The Nationalists, it may be said, have only themselves to blame for their heavy losses at the polls. Monarchists at heart, few of them accepted the Republic or were willing to assist in making it a success. They scoffed at Locarno and Geneva. Like the Bourbons they learned nothing and forgot nothing". The DNVP [Deutschnationale Volkspartei or German National People's Party] was a national conservative party in Germany during the time of the Weimar Republic; the party lost many seats in the 1928 election.
